The TTPlanet_Tile_Preprocessor_GF node is designed to enhance and preprocess images by applying a series of transformations that improve their quality and prepare them for further processing or analysis. This node is particularly useful for AI artists who want to refine their images by adjusting specific parameters such as blur strength and scale factor, which can significantly impact the visual output. The node's primary goal is to provide a flexible and efficient way to preprocess images, making them more suitable for various artistic applications. By leveraging this node, you can achieve smoother transitions and enhanced details in your images, which are crucial for creating high-quality digital art.
The image
parameter is the primary input for the node, representing the image that you want to preprocess. This parameter is essential as it serves as the base for all subsequent transformations and enhancements applied by the node.
The scale_factor
parameter allows you to adjust the size of the image. It accepts a floating-point value with a default of 2.00, a minimum of 1.00, and a maximum of 8.00, with increments of 0.05. This parameter is crucial for scaling the image up or down, which can be useful for focusing on specific details or fitting the image to a desired resolution.
The blur_strength
parameter controls the intensity of the blur effect applied to the image. It accepts a floating-point value with a default of 1.0, a minimum of 1.0, and a maximum of 20.0, with increments of 0.1. This parameter is important for smoothing out noise and creating a softer appearance in the image, which can enhance the overall aesthetic.
The image_output
parameter represents the processed image after all transformations have been applied. This output is crucial as it provides the final result of the preprocessing, which can then be used for further artistic manipulation or analysis. The processed image will have improved quality and may exhibit enhanced details and smoother transitions, depending on the input parameters.
